- The distance between Elmira, Ny, Usa and Nuriootpa, Australia is approximately 16,794 km or 10,436 mi.
- To reach Elmira, Ny in this distance one would set out from Nuriootpa bearing 63.8°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Elmira, Ny bearing 93.4° or E .
- Elmira, Ny has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Nuriootpa has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b).
- Elmira, Ny is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Nuriootpa is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ome.
- The average temperature is 6.7 °C (12.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.6 °C (24.5°F) more in Elmira, Ny.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 342.4 mm (13.5 in) more which is equivalent to 342.4 l/m² (8.4 US gal/ft²) or 3,424,000 l/ha (366,048 US gal/ac) more. About 1 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7° lower in Elmira, Ny than in Nuriootpa.
